Description

β€’ BioMarin is a global biotechnology company that relentlessly pursues bold science to translate genetic discoveries into new medicines that advance the future of human health. β€’ The Global Medical Lead is a critical leadership role in Global Medical Affairs, working on global activities for BioMarin's PKU portfolio. β€’ Responsible for providing medical input into development, execution and interpretation of Clinical Development Plans, clinical protocols, including review of draft external research protocols, reports and manuscripts. β€’ Ensure compliance with policies, SOPs, Code of Business Conduct and Corporate Social Responsibility, as well as relevant legislation and regulations.

Requirements

β€’ MD, PhD, PharmD or other advanced life sciences degree required. β€’ Extensive industry experience, especially in Medical Affairs (β‰₯ 7 years) and Clinical Development, ideally in global roles. β€’ Experience in PKU is desirable, either in pharmaceutical/clinical research or a clinical environment. β€’ Experience in Genetic Medicine is a plus. β€’ Ability to work, influence, and gain consensus across regions and cross-functional teams. β€’ Demonstrate solid understanding of cross-functional inter-dependencies across the drug development lifecycle. β€’ Excellent communication skills and a strong enterprise mindset required for problem solving and high-level presentations for senior executive staff review. β€’ US and international experience working in orphan or specialty markets. β€’ Have ability to design studies, develop protocols and monitor studies in a wide range of study types and phases including pre and post marketing. β€’ Knowledgeable and current in GCP guidelines and compliance rules globally. β€’ Clinical trial and publication experience is desirable. β€’ Track record with successfully influencing without authority, partnering across functions especially with but not limited to commercial. β€’ Solid business acumen with high scientific inquisitiveness. β€’ Able to thrive in an ambiguous and demanding environment, with high capacity for effective relationship building and teamwork. β€’ Flexibility and adaptability. β€’ Sensitivity to a multicultural environment. β€’ Willingness to travel, mostly internationally. β€’ English proficiency required.
